Saint-Jean Saint-Nicolas

Departement of the Hautes Alpes - Population : 781 inh. - Altitude : 1,134 m.

puce 25 km North-East of Gap via the N85 and the D944.
Saint-Jean Saint-Nicolas, mountain village


In the upper Champsaur valley, in the heart of the Ecrins National Park, ou'll find the municipality of Saint-Jean Saint-Nicolas, a group of hamlets the largest of which is called Pont-du-Fossé.

Overlooking the superb broad valley of Drac Noir are a few perched houses, built from massive blocks of grey stone, with lauze roofs, set against a backdrop of vertical rock cliffs, around a picturesque belltower.

In such a tranquil spot, without a care in the world you'll be able to admire the round tower with its pointed roof, standing nobly in a verdant meadow.

This fine structure is all that remains of a medieval castle where according to historians "five families lived in succession from 1274 to the Revolution in 1789"...
